Luckily this multi-million dollar beachfront home in Debordieu Colony, Georgetown, S.C. was vacant at the time of this conflagration last week. Imagine the heat that this fire generated. Several other homes in the area were damaged by heat and flying, burning debris. The cause of this fire is still under investigation. Our thoughts and prayers go out to the owners of this home and no amount of insurance can replace the beachfront memories that this home held. We are thankful that no owners, guests or emergency personnel were injured or killed in this Debordieu fire tragedy.
